将所有zip文件添加到新文件中

时间:2010-03-31 15:15:40

标签: java zip

Guys有办法将所有zip文件添加到新的zip文件中。

3 个答案:

答案 0 :(得分:1)

你的问题不是很清楚......但你应该看看java.util.zip包...

编辑:如果您想使用库,您还可以查看apache的commons压缩库(http://commons.apache.org/compress),它允许您创建ArchiveOutputStream并将您的文件添加为ZipEntry(请参阅示例在javadoc:http://commons.apache.org/compress/apidocs/org/apache/commons/compress/archivers/ArchiveStreamFactory.html

答案 1 :(得分:0)

是肯定的。但压缩文件大小不会改变太多

这[文章] [1]解释得很好

希望它可以帮到你

[1]:这篇文章解释得很好:http://kb.winzip.com/kb/?View=entry&EntryID=104

答案 2 :(得分:-1)

在终端中(如果您的操作系统是Linux或Mac,或者您在Windows中使用Cygwin):

gzip *.zip > newzip.zip